Displaying Physician 85 - 94 of 94 in total
Chelsea Takamatsu MD
-
300 Pasteur Dr
Palo Alto, CA, 94305 - (650) 721-6680
Jianling Tao MD
-
300 Pasteur Dr
Stanford, CA, 94305 - (650) 723-6961
Aileen Wang MD
-
300 Pasteur Dr
Stanford, CA, 94305 - (650) 723-4000
Vasyl Warvariv MD
-
300 Pasteur Dr
Stanford, CA, 94305 - (650) 723-6961
Margaret Yu MD
-
300 Pasteur Dr
Stanford, CA, 94305 - (650) 723-4000
Susan Ziolkowski MD
-
300 Pasteur Dr
Stanford, CA, 94305 - (650) 723-4000
Dr. Michelle O'Shaughnessy MD
-
777 Welch Rd
Palo Alto, CA, 94304 - (650) 725-4738
Jane Tan MD
-
750 Welch Rd
Palo Alto, CA, 94304 - (650) 725-9891
William Peters MD
-
260 International Cir
San Jose, CA, 95119 - (408) 972-7000
Deepa Ramaswamy MD
-
260 International Cir
San Jose, CA, 95119 - (408) 972-7000